Fiinu Plc (LON:BANK – Get Free Report) fell 10.2% on Tuesday . The company traded as low as GBX 3.08 and last traded at GBX 3.23. Approximately 1,032,803 shares traded hands during trading, an increase of 192% from the average daily volume of 353,462 shares. The stock had previously closed at GBX 3.60.
Fiinu Stock Performance
The stock has a market capitalization of £13.86 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-7.00 and a beta of 8.23. The business has a 50-day moving average of GBX 5.22 and a 200-day moving average of GBX 6.75.
Fiinu (LON:BANK –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Monday, June 29th. The company reported GBX (2.98) EPS for the quarter. Fiinu had a net margin of 57.24% and a negative return on equity of 593.28%.
About Fiinu
Fiinu plc is a UK-based fintech group delivering open banking-enabled infrastructure and financial services across lending and brokerage.
At the heart of Fiinu’s strategy is the Plugin Overdraft®, a white-label solution that integrates seamlessly into existing banking applications, allowing customers to access arranged overdrafts without switching banks. This product addresses the needs of the 80% of UK account holders who currently lack access to overdrafts. Using real-time Open Banking data and AI-driven underwriting, Fiinu can assess affordability responsibly and provide fair overdraft limits—helping fill the £10 billion gap left by the removal of unarranged overdrafts in 2020.
